Filters:
clear
Country: United Kingdom

barbecue restaurant in New Marske

About 1 results.

BarBQ Night

Middlesbrough, TS5 5HA Middlesbrough, United Kingdom

Bar BQ Night welcomes you! Pizza and grill takeaway in Middlesbrough Be sure to try our delicious grill dishes and pizza, you will definitely like them!

  • 1